Output 70fdeb262e0660d26b7a2058d8d1e8ca663a158581c9a16a218ba6bb6394d7f2:0

value
20817388
script pubkey
OP_0 OP_PUSHBYTES_20 b81a9fcabef1108ab7c3a3f9fee90278b8cb3b45
address
bc1qhqdflj477ygg4d7r50ula6gz0zuvkw69f68y6v
transaction
70fdeb262e0660d26b7a2058d8d1e8ca663a158581c9a16a218ba6bb6394d7f2
spent
true